The safety of passengers on ships is a paramount concern for maritime authorities around the world. One critical aspect of this safety is the Regulation of Explosives in Passenger Ships. This regulation encompasses a set of guidelines and laws designed to prevent accidents and ensure the safe transport of passengers and goods. The use of explosives on passenger vessels can pose significant risks, not only to those onboard but also to the marine environment and surrounding communities. Therefore, strict regulations are essential to mitigate these dangers.To understand the importance of the Regulation of Explosives in Passenger Ships, we must first recognize the potential threats that explosives can bring. Explosives are often used in various industries, including construction and mining, but their presence on passenger ships requires careful consideration. An explosion could lead to catastrophic consequences, including loss of life, injuries, and extensive damage to the ship and its cargo. Moreover, the repercussions of such incidents can extend beyond the immediate area, affecting marine ecosystems and coastal populations.International maritime organizations, such as the International Maritime Organization (IMO), have established comprehensive frameworks to address the regulation of hazardous materials, including explosives. These frameworks outline safety measures and best practices that shipping companies must adhere to when transporting explosives. For example, passenger ships must be equipped with proper storage facilities that meet specific standards to prevent accidental detonations. Additionally, crew members must receive training on handling explosives safely and responding to emergencies effectively.The Regulation of Explosives in Passenger Ships also involves thorough inspections and audits by maritime authorities. Ships are required to undergo regular assessments to ensure compliance with safety regulations. These inspections include checking storage areas, verifying the integrity of safety equipment, and reviewing emergency response plans. Such rigorous oversight helps identify potential hazards before they escalate into serious incidents.Furthermore, effective communication between shipping companies, regulatory bodies, and passengers is vital. Passengers should be informed about the safety measures in place regarding explosives and what to do in case of an emergency. Clear signage and announcements can help raise awareness and prepare passengers for any situation that may arise. By fostering a culture of safety, the maritime industry can enhance passenger confidence and trust.In conclusion, the Regulation of Explosives in Passenger Ships plays a crucial role in ensuring the safety of passengers and the protection of the marine environment. Through stringent guidelines, regular inspections, and effective communication, the risks associated with transporting explosives can be significantly minimized. As the maritime industry continues to evolve, it is imperative that these regulations remain robust and adaptive to new challenges. Ultimately, the goal is to create a safer and more secure experience for all who travel by sea.
